Encourages Collaboration
Your workforce is going to perform better when they work together. Well, that is the good thing about a digital workplace. This is a place that is going to foster and encourage collaboration. It provides a hub where everybody is going to go and people are able to communicate through this space.
A digital workplace allows everybody to see a project. It makes things easier for working together and achieving great results. It also allows employees to step away from emails, which are often distracting and can allow miscommunication. There is a better collaborative atmosphere in a digital workplace.

Stops Wasting Time
There are many organizations out there that are running inefficiently and not even realizing it. One of the reasons for this is a lack of collaboration and knowledge sharing. For example, say you are working on a similar project that you had a couple of years ago. If you had a system for collaboration and allowed data to be shared easily with that team, this would make processes more efficient for the next project.
But, the problem is, if you do not have a system for sharing, you end up wasting time as a business. This can lead to more expenses in the long run. So, that is why it is best to invest in a digital workplace. This is going to be somewhere that your employees can go to gain information. It can boost efficiency and stop wasting time on a day-to-day basis.
